Saves {image, video, audio, links, selection, page} in directories relative to the default download directory.
Adds a context menu to save media {image, video, audio, link, selection, page} in user-defined folders or directories relative to the default download location.
Save into dynamically named directories.
Flexible rules-based download renaming and routing.
Option to save as shortcuts {.url, .desktop, .html redirect}.
The WebExtension API only allows saving into directories relative to the default download directory. Symlinks can be used to get around this limitation:
Windows: mklink /D C:\path\to\symlink D:\path\to\actual
macOS/Unix: ln -s /path/to/actual /path/to/symlink
Make sure the actual directories exist, or downloads will silently fail.
<all_urls> permission is used to get around CORS on HTTP HEAD requests (to check for Content-Disposition headers)
tabs permission is used to get the active page's title.
